这份指南将从 入门基础 到 进阶技巧,并包含 资源推荐,帮助您系统地学习 RealFlow 2025。

第一部分:入门基础
在开始之前,请确保您已经安装了 RealFlow 2025 和它的配套渲染器(如 Cinema 4D, 3ds Max, Maya 等,通过 RF Connect 连接)。
理解核心概念
RealFlow 的工作流程与传统三维软件不同,它更专注于“模拟”本身,您需要理解几个核心概念:
- 发射器: 模拟的源头,用于创建流体、粒子、刚体等,水龙头是水的发射器,沙子是粒子的发射器。
- 物体: 模拟中的“容器”或“障碍物”,一个杯子、一个人物模型、一个场景中的地面,流体会与这些物体发生交互。
- 域: 这是模拟的“世界”或“空间”,它定义了模拟的边界、重力、分辨率等全局物理参数。几乎所有模拟都必须在 Domain 内进行。
- 模拟节点: 这是 RealFlow 的核心,它负责计算物理模拟,并生成模拟数据文件(.bin 或 .rs 文件),模拟完成后,这些文件可以被导入到主程序中进行渲染。
- 缓存: 模拟结果会以缓存文件的形式保存在硬盘上,这避免了每次都要重新计算。
界面初探
启动 RealFlow 2025,您会看到几个主要窗口:
- 视窗: 3D 视图,用于放置和调整发射器、物体等。
- 节点面板: 显示场景中所有节点的层级关系,是管理和连接节点的核心。
- 参数面板: 当您选中一个节点(如发射器、Domain)时,这里会显示其所有可调节的参数。
- 脚本/消息面板: 用于编写脚本和查看系统信息。
你的第一个模拟:一杯水
这个经典案例能让你快速理解 RealFlow 的基本工作流程。

步骤 1:创建场景
- 打开 RealFlow 2025。
- 在菜单栏选择
File > New Scene(文件 > 新建场景)。
步骤 2:创建 Domain
- 在节点面板中,右键点击
Scene(场景),选择Standard > Domain。 - 在视窗中会出现一个代表 Domain 的立方线框,在参数面板中调整其尺寸,
Size X/Y/Z都设为200,确保它能容纳你的场景。 - 关键: 在参数面板中,确保
Gravity(重力) 的 Z 轴值为-9.81(默认值),这是模拟地球重力。
步骤 3:创建杯子
- 在节点面板中,右键点击
Scene,选择Standard > Object。 - 在视窗中会出现一个默认的球体,我们把它变成杯子。
- 在参数面板中,找到
Geometry(几何体) 选项,点击Browse(浏览),选择一个杯子模型(.obj或.fbx格式),导入后,调整其位置和大小,使其位于 Domain 内部。
步骤 4:创建水发射器

- 在节点面板中,右键点击
Scene,选择Particles > Hybrido > Emitter。 - 将这个发射器放置在杯子模型的正上方。
- 在参数面板中,调整
Particle emission(粒子发射) 参数:Rate: 发射速率,值越大,水流越急。Speed: 初始速度。Life: 粒子存活时间。Particle size: 粒子大小。
步骤 5:连接节点 这是 RealFlow 的关键步骤!节点必须正确连接才能工作。
- 在节点面板中,按住
Ctrl键,同时选中Hybrido Emitter和Domain。 - 点击节点面板上方的
Connect按钮(或按C键)。 Hybrido Emitter下面会多出一条线指向Domain,表示发射器在 Domain 内工作。- 同样地,选中
Object(杯子) 和Domain,将它们也连接起来。
步骤 6:进行模拟
- 在视窗下方,找到模拟控制条。
- 点击
Start Simulation(开始模拟) 按钮。 - 您会看到粒子从发射器流出,与杯子碰撞并填充,视窗底部会显示模拟进度(帧数)。
- 模拟完成后,点击
Stop Simulation(停止模拟)。
步骤 7:导入到主程序(如 Cinema 4D)
- 在 RealFlow 中,选中
Hybrido Emitter节点。 - 在参数面板中,找到
Output(输出) 部分,点击Open Bin Folder(打开缓存文件夹),查看生成的.rs文件。 - 打开 RF Connect(打开 Cinema 4D 并加载 RealFlow C4D 插件)。
- 在 C4D 中创建一个对象,将其 RealFlow 标签中的
Simulation(模拟) 类型设置为Hybrido,然后指向你刚才生成的.rs文件。 - 播放时间轴,你就能在 C4D 中看到水流的动画了。
第二部分:进阶技巧与常用节点
掌握了基础后,我们可以探索更强大的功能。
粒子类型
- 标准粒子: 最基础,用于模拟沙子、灰尘、雪等不连续的颗粒。
- Hybrido (高级流体): RealFlow 的明星功能,用于模拟真实的水、油、熔岩等液体,它结合了粒子网格和流体动力学,效果逼真,但计算量也更大。
- Caronte (刚体): 用于模拟物理刚体,如石头、砖块、破碎的碎片,可以与流体交互。
关键节点与参数调整
-
Daemons (力场): 这是模拟效果的关键。
- Gravity: 重力,可以调整方向和强度。
- Drag: 阻力,模拟空气阻力,让粒子运动更真实。
- Force: 力场,可以吸引或排斥粒子。
- Noise: 噪声力场,让流体产生湍流和混乱效果。
- Vortex: 漩涡力场,创建旋转效果。
- 使用方法: 创建 Daemon 节点,然后将其连接到
Domain上。
-
Mesh (网格): 将 Hybrido 粒子转换成可渲染的网格表面。
- 在节点面板中,右键点击
Scene,选择Meshing > Mesh。 - 将
Hybrido Emitter连接到Mesh节点上。 - 在
Mesh节点的参数中,可以调整网格的细节 (Resolution)、平滑度等。 - 同样,将
Mesh连接到Domain。
- 在节点面板中,右键点击
-
Material (材质): 为粒子或网格赋予材质属性。
- 在节点面板中,右键点击
Scene,选择Materials > Material。 - 双击
Material节点,在参数面板中调整颜色、反射、透明度等。 - 将这个
Material节点连接到你的Hybrido Emitter或Mesh节点上。
- 在节点面板中,右键点击
优化模拟性能
- Domain Resolution: Domain 的分辨率越高,模拟细节越好,但计算时间呈指数级增长,初学者可以从较低的值(如 60-80)开始。
- 粒子限制: 在
Hybrido Emitter中设置Max particles(最大粒子数),避免场景中粒子过多导致崩溃。 - 缓存管理: 定期清理不再需要的缓存文件,节省硬盘空间。
- 使用子域: 对于大型场景,可以使用
Subdomain来只模拟需要计算的局部区域,大大提升效率。
第三部分:学习资源推荐
由于 RealFlow 2025 较老,最新的官方教程已不多,但社区资源依然非常丰富。
视频教程
- YouTube / Bilibili: 这是最好的学习平台,搜索关键词:
RealFlow 2025 tutorialRealFlow Hybrido tutorialRealFlow Caronte tutorialRealFlow Daemons tutorial- 推荐频道/UP主:
- FlippedNormals: 虽然他们的教程较新,但讲解的流体模拟核心原理非常清晰,可以举一反三。
- Cineversity (旧教程): 曾经是 Maxon 官方教程网站,有大量关于 RealFlow for Cinema 4D 的经典教程,很多内容对 2025 版本依然适用。
- 个人博主: 在 Bilibili 和 YouTube 上搜索 "RealFlow 教程",能找到很多国内用户分享的从入门到进阶的系列视频。
文档与官方资源
- 官方用户手册: 这是最权威的资料,安装 RealFlow 后,在开始菜单或 Help (帮助) 菜单中可以找到,PDF 格式的手册详细介绍了每个节点的功能和参数。
- 官方论坛 (旧版): RealFlow 官方论坛(可能已关闭或迁移)的存档是解决问题的宝贵资源,使用搜索引擎搜索 "RealFlow forum 2025 + 你的问题"。
示例场景
- RealFlow 2025 的安装包里通常包含一些示例场景,仔细研究这些场景的节点连接和参数设置,是快速学习高级技巧的捷径,它们通常位于安装目录的
scenes或examples文件夹中。
社区与问答
- ArtStation: 搜索 "RealFlow",可以看到很多艺术家的作品,有时他们会分享制作过程。
- Stack Exchange (3D Graphics): 可以在这里提问,但提问时最好附上你的场景截图和参数设置。
总结与学习建议
- 从简单开始: 不要一上来就挑战海啸或复杂的破碎,先从“一杯水”、“一桶沙子”开始,确保每个步骤都理解透彻。
- 理解原理: RealFlow 是物理模拟,多思考物理规律,为什么水会这样流动?为什么沙子会这样堆积?理解了原理,你才能调出想要的,而不仅仅是“看起来像”的效果。
- 耐心是关键: 流体模拟非常耗时,尤其是 Hybrido,要有耐心等待计算完成,并学会优化。
- 模仿与创新: 找到优秀的教程和案例,跟着做一遍,然后尝试修改参数,加入自己的创意,看看会发生什么变化。
希望这份详细的指南能帮助您顺利开启 RealFlow 2025 的学习之旅!祝您学习愉快!
